Plain-language summary (this site, from the cited record only)

County Correctional Police Officer Adrian Diaz called out sick for his tour of duty but did not have enough accrued sick time to cover his shift, the Bergen County Sheriffs Office reported for 2025. He was placed in a no pay status and considered Absent Without Leave. Following the progressive discipline schedule, Diaz was suspended for 20 days.

Plain-language summary (this site, from the cited record only)

Officer Adrian Diaz was found to be in violation of the sick leave policy after using more sick time than he had accrued, the Bergen County Sheriffs Office reported for 2022. Diaz was suspended for 10 days. Sustained charges included absence without leave and abuse of sick leave.
